BF moms I need help transitioning to formula

I have been breasting feeding Stephanie for the past 9 1/2 months. It's been tough (I don't pump) but am proud that I was able to do it this long. But now that I'm pregnant my supply is shot. Over the past 9 months I would ocassionally give her a bottle if we were out but she never really took to it. Now that she needs to I'm having a really difficult time getting her to drink formula. She wants to nurse. I try but it's just not filling her up. When she does take a bottle it's usually 1-2 oz and last night she took 3. Daddy tries to give her a bottle but I have more luck. Can anyone offer any tips to help make this transition easier on both of us? Also can you recommend bottles and nipple size? I have no idea where to start.

  • I would try some of the following: If your milk is usually squirting out at her, try a medium (or fast) flow nipple- she may just be having to work too hard with the bottle and that can frustrate babies.  If she usually has to work at getting milk, and she seems to be overwhelmed by the bottle (or choking) use a slow flow nipple.

     Second, my  cousin's baby did this too and she literally had to LEAVE the house and have her husband give the bottle when she was REALLY hungry.  Also, are you mixing breastmilk and formula?  Do you have a pump?  If you do, I would try mixing only a little formula with a lot of breastmilk at first (like 2 oz to 4-6 oz ratio).  Then ease her into more formula. 

     Honestly, at this point it will probably take her a while to transition, so be patient and try different things.

     And, for the next baby, I would introduce a bottle of breastmilk once a day (or a few times a week) by 3-6 weeks so that when you do want to switch to formula they are only dealing with a different taste, not trying to adapt to the bottle as well.

  • I am trying to slowly wean and it's tough. ?He was never that great with a bottle and my milk stash is gone so we're on to formula too. ?I'm giving him one bottle a day to replace a feeding. ?I'm using Good Start Ready-to-feed which he seems to like better than powder. ?I have found that I can't give it to him anywhere he associates with nursing or he just tries to rip off my shirt. ?I give it to him in the living room and he'll drink a bit, then he wants to play so I let him, and I just keep offering it and surprisingly he will drink it a little at a time like that, kind of on-the-go. ?I figure it's a start anyways. ?When DH gives it he has the same problems. ?

    Oh, and we use MAM Anti-colic bottles currently with #2 nipples, but I'm about to go and get some #3s to see if he likes those better. ?We've tried Avent, Breastflow, Adiri, and Medela, and the MAM is the one he likes best. ?I get them at BRU.?
